DOšEK, Tomáš. Nationalization of Parties and Party Systems in Latin America: Concept, Measurement and Recent Development in the Region. Polít. gob [online]. 2015, vol.22, n.2, pp.347-390. ISSN 1665-2037.

The goal of this article is to contribute to a burgeoning comparative literature about nationalization of party competition (political parties and party systems), clarifying its terminology and evaluating three different indices of measurement of this phenomenon and used recently in Latin America. This paper argues that despite the confusion in the terminology, the term nationalization should be understood as homogeneity of electoral support across the territory and that a proper measure of nationalization should take into account four basic elements: party presence across the country, number of subnational units where it is measured, its magnitude and the size of the party. The revision of the literature dedicated to Latin American countries reveals that more case studies of long-term evolution of party systems and explanation of its changes and party-centred variables are necessary.
